Analysis: Will Trump-Stricken India Bring BRICS Group Closer? Is Trump’s Anger Directed at BRICS Nations?

The BRICS economies are observing with concern a united front against American trade barriers as India, deeply affected by Trump’s policies, may prompt a reevaluation of the BRICS trend of challenging the dominance of the dollar. The confrontational approach of the Trump administration has pushed India and other BRICS nations closer together, forging stronger bonds amidst shared challenges. Russia, China, Brazil, and South Africa are now mobilizing to resist the protectionist measures imposed by the US, suggesting a shifting landscape in international trade dynamics. The Trump administration’s aggressive trade policy has stirred reactions from developing economies, potentially bringing the BRICS group even tighter in response to the challenges posed by American tariffs.
